Position Summary
I & E Technician II is a journey level position responsible for independently performing installation, commissioning, maintenance, and troubleshooting of instrumentation, control systems, and automation equipment used in oil and gas production, processing, and pipeline operations. Working under general supervision, the technician executes complex field tasks, provides technical guidance to Technician I personnel, and contributes to continuous improvement of maintenance programs. All work is performed in accordance with safety, environmental, and regulatory requirements.
Key Responsibilities
- Installation & Commissioning: Independently install, wire, and commission field instruments including pressure transmitters, flow meters, level sensors, thermocouples, RTDs, and control valves; perform loop checkout and functional testing with minimal supervision.
- Maintenance & Calibration: Lead scheduled preventive maintenance and calibration activities for instrumentation and control equipment; develop and refine calibration procedures to improve accuracy and efficiency.
- Troubleshooting: Diagnose and resolve malfunctions in field instruments, control panels, PLCs, RTUs, and associated wiring; apply structured root cause analysis to identify and address recurring failures.
- SCADA Support: Configure, modify, and troubleshoot SCADA, PLC, and RTU based control systems; execute and document changes in accordance with MOC procedures; support alarm management and HMI updates.
- Electrical Systems: Independently install and maintain low voltage electrical systems, including intrinsically safe and explosion proof equipment in classified hazardous areas (Class I Div 1/2).
- Documentation: Create and maintain accurate work orders, calibration records, as built drawings, and equipment histories in the CMMS; identify and correct documentation deficiencies.
- Mentorship: Provide day to day guidance and on the job training to Technician I personnel; review their work for quality and safety compliance.
- Safety & Compliance: Lead JSAs and field level risk assessments; ensure all work complies with HSE policies, OSHA regulations, API standards, and site procedures; actively promote a safety first culture.

QualificationsMinimum

Qualifications
- 2–7 years of hands on experience in industrial instrumentation, automation, or electrical work in an oil and gas environment.
- Proficient understanding of process instrumentation concepts including 4–20 mA loops, HART, Modbus, and Foundation Fieldbus.
- Demonstrated ability to independently calibrate, troubleshoot, and repair field instruments and control systems.
- Experience with Emerson FB107, Emerson FB3000 or ABB (GS, G4, G5) platforms, including basic program review and modification.
- Valid driver’s license with acceptable driving record; ability to travel to field sites.
Preferred

Qualifications
- Experience with Allen Bradley (Rockwell Automation), Siemens, or ABB PLC platforms including online program modification
- Working knowledge of SCADA platforms (Ignition)
- Prior experience in midstream or upstream oil and gas operations a plus

About Flywheel Energy, LLC

Flywheel Energy is a private exploration and production company formed to provide American consumers with reliable, affordable energy by acquiring and sustainably operating large, producing onshore U.S. oil and gas assets.

In August of 2018, the Fund committed a second time to the management team with $700 million of equity in the form of the newly-formed Flywheel Energy. Flywheel Energy is a private exploration and production company formed to acquire and operate large, producing onshore U.S. oil and gas assets with an emphasis on the Rockies and Mid-Continent.

Concurrent with the new commitment, Flywheel signed a definitive agreement to acquire Southwestern Energy’s legacy gas properties and affiliated midstream business in the Fayetteville Shale in Arkansas for $1,865 Million. With this acquisition, Flywheel entities will have made almost $2.1 billion of acquisitions since 2017.
